MoErgo Glove80

It is so comfortable that the downsides do not matter

I spent quite a bit of time with the Glove80, and I have to say - this keyboard is a game-changer when it comes to comfort. The key well design creates this natural curvature that your hands just sink into, making typing feel incredibly natural. What really stood out was how it actually forced me to correct my bad typing habits because of its columnar layout.

The curved design also means less finger travel, which contributed to the overall comfort. I found that my RSI issues, which would typically flare up with other keyboards, completely disappeared when using the Glove80. The thumb cluster design is pretty clever, though I ended up mainly using the bottom three keys.

While there are some quirks with the configuration software and a few design compromises, the typing comfort is so exceptional that these downsides become insignificant. The keyboard isn't perfect - it's lightweight and requires some care in handling, plus you can't hot-swap switches. But for anyone dealing with RSI or seeking ultimate typing comfort, this keyboard is a solid recommendation despite its $360 price tag.
